Riak database pdf file download

The design goals are to see the slide riak python client public github repo rcgenovariaktsdemo riak ts open source due midapril. Now that riak has been installed, each node will need to be configured. Each of the four nodes contains eight nodes or eight rings, thus providing a 32ring partition for use. This talk will be about database choices, mistakes, successes, and.

The movement began early 2009 and is growing rapidly. Oracle nosql database provides keyvalue pair data management over a distributed set of storage nodes, providing automatic data partitioning, distribution, query load. Fakeriak is an inmemory java implementation of the riak interface. Includes heaps of practical material on how to use nosql databases like redis, mongodb, couchdb, riak and cassandra. This is part 1 of a twopart series about riak, a highly scalable, distributed data store written in erlang and based on dynamo, amazons high availability keyvalue store. Riak pronounced reeack is a distributed nosql keyvalue data store that offers high availability, fault tolerance, operational simplicity, and scalability. Learn how to model your data to fit in with riaks eventually consistent world view. A haskell client for the riak decentralized data store.

I have problem with pdf as i want to download pdf file from sql server saved in image field,when i press download button it work but toll me that the files was damaged. Sure, giving up acid buys us a lot performance, but doesnt our crude organization cost us something. So the misleading term nosql the community now translates it mostly with not only sql should. Eric liaw riak for games presented by basho technologies. Users include comcast, yammer, voxer, boeing, seomoz, joyent, kiip. The original intention has been modern webscale database management systems. Riak kv provides a keyvalue datastore and features mapreduce, lightweight data relations, and several different client apis. Viewing pdf files requires free adobe acrobat reader. The file can view but while saving it to local folder, instead of saving it as.

We discuss the design of a new convergent statebased replicated datatype, the map, as implemented by the riak dt library 4 and the riak data store 3. It follows the same ring topology and gossip protocols in the underpinning architecture. Some of riaks other features will also be introduced. Very confusing stuff for people that have never used the framework before. Best open source databases for iot applications open. Oracle nosql database is a distributed, highly performant, highly available scalable keyvalue database. A handy and outright awesome ebook guide to the world of nosql databases. Riak is a distributed nosql database that offers highavailability, fault tolerance, operational simplicity, and scalability. The active file is written by appending a new entry below. As we discussed in chapter 1, we can think of coupling in terms of domain coupling, temporal coupling, or implementation coupling.

Document database an overview sciencedirect topics. Of the three, its implementation coupling that often occupies us most when considering databases, because of the prevalence of people sharing a database among multiple schemas, as we see in figure 41. During this procedure, data in relation to players profile should be. Nosql databases polyglot persistence a note on the future of data storage in the enterprise, written primarily for those. It uses riak kv for statebased objectdocument storage and riak ts for eventbased storage.

If you want to make this work every time you start a shell you need to put it it the rc file of your shell of choice, for bash its. Riak implements the principles from amazons dynamo paper with heavy influence from the cap theorem. Database tutorial tutorials for database and associated technologies including memcached, neo4j, imsdb, db2, redis, mongodb, sql, mysql, plsql, sqlite, postgresql. Type of nosql databases and its comparison with relational databases. Ensure that there are no instances of riak currently running, change into the riak configuration directory, and open the primary configuration file. Enterprise nosql database scalable database solutions riak. Decomposing the database monolith to microservices book.

Eric liaw riak for games presented by basho technologies topics gdc. In my last post, i showed you how to fix an example from from the seven databases in seven weeks to run against riak 1. I have to download most recent uploaded pdf file from mysql database using php. The book has chapters about berkleydb, hadoop distributed file system hdfs, the nosql ecosystem, and riak. An extension of the leastprivileged database login is to use multiple database logins for applications that require write as well. How to save pdf files in database and create a search. Riak is everything that datomic needs, except for the one piece of strongly consistent data. Coming to riak requires rethinking of data modeling and access patterns. In each of the implementations, nosql databases riak and mongodb act as a stable storage for the users application i. Riak enterprise was a commercial version of the database offered by basho, the projects sponsor, with advanced multidata.

An empirical study of nosql databases by using mongodb. We will complete the following steps on each machine. With this database, the user can associate a large number of data points with a specific point in time. In addition to the opensource version, it comes in a supported enterprise version and a cloud storage version. Basho was the developer of riak, an open source distributed database that offers high availability, fault tolerance, operation simplicity and scalability. Riak is a distributed, decentralized data storage system. Multiple database an overview sciencedirect topics. Riak, ehcache get foo foo bar 2 fast 6 0 9 0 0 9 text pic 1055 stuff bar foo get cart. Nkbase distributed database erlang from the webpage. Big data, base, cap, cloud computing, nosql, cassan. How to setup riak kv nosql database cluster on centos 7. Riak humbly claims to be the most powerful opensource, distributed database youll ever put into production.

This repo is now a reusable library of quickcheck tested implementations of crdts. A brief history of big data pittsburgh supercomputing center. Nkbase uses a nomaster, sharenothing architecture, where no node has any special role. Pdf portable document format rdbms relational database management system. Like traditional dictionary data structures, the map associates keys with values, and provides operations to add, remove, and mutate entries. Survey of nosql database engines for big data masters thesis espoo, may 11, 2015. Note that runing gsea using rnk files needs to be initiated from gsea main menu tools gseapreranked. Riak has been written in erlang, and part of basho products that provide different version, including riak kv keyvalue, riak ts optimized for iottime series, and riak cs riak cloud storage. This talk will be about database choices, mistakes, successes, and lessons learned by the presenters.

A delete is a simply a write of a tombstone value, which indicates an entry must be removed on the next merge. How to create a riak cluster on an ubuntu vps digitalocean. The genes are then ranked by fold change and the file saved in a text file with. Mongodb is the leading nosql database, with significant adoption among the fortune 500 and global 500. Initially built as a keyvalue data store, very similar to amazon dynamodb, riak has since evolved and now integrates highly advanced functions that have allowed it to stand out from the competition. It is one of the core pieces of the upcoming neksos software defined data center platform, netcomposer. The gis data and services are designed to provide the user with the ability to determine the flood zone, base flood elevation, and floodway status for. In this tutorial, we will show you to stepbystep how to install and configure the nosql database riak kv on ubuntu 18. Youll be surprised how efficiently you can store even the simplest data like json documents alongside. Cassandra, mongodb, and riak are four nosql datastores selected for the benchmarking experiments. Updated examples for seven databases in seven weeks. Riak has been written in erlang and is part of the basho product line that includes riak kv keyvalue, riak ts optimized for. Riak is a distributed, fault tolerant, open source database that illustrates how to build large scale systems using erlangotp.

Download pdf file from sql server database the asp. This library is a fast haskell client for the riak decentralized keyvalue data store. It is similar in architecture to cassandra, and the default is set up as a fournode cluster. Fakeriak is an inmemory java implementation of parts of the riak interface. Distributed databases cassandra riak voldemort dynomite, simpledb etc. Uses normal riak settings for n,w, and dw, but for r, the setting is. It involves a systematic examination of a workplace to identify hazards, assess injury severity and likelihood and. Now we need to check that everything is setup correctly, we will do that by creating a template and building it. Chose riak kv flexible keyvalue data model for web scale profile and session management, realtime big data, catalog, content management, customer 360, digital messaging, and more use cases. Riak is the swiss army knife of unstructured data storage. Riak provides all this, while still focused on ease of operations.

Net library which facilitates communication with riak, an open source, distributed database that focuses on high availability, horizontal scalability, and predictable latency. A risk assessment template is a tool used to identify and control risks in the workplace. Basho riak a dynamoinspired keyvalue store with a distributed database network platform. R1, notfoundok false first found semantics most efficient way of reading from riak. In the wiki, you will find the quick start directions for setting up and using riak. Thanks in large part to erlangs support for massively scalable distributed systems, riak offers features that are uncommon in databases, such as highavailability and linear scalability of both capacity and throughput. Gdelt global database of events, language, and tone also soon to be hosted on bridges. The national flood hazard layer nfhl is a compilation of gis data that comprises a nationwide digital flood insurance rate map. Both riak and this code is maintained by basho installation. A database refers to the data itself and its organization, while database management system dbms is the software framework that provides access to that data. Nosql databases polyglot persistence martin fowler. It is primarly used for testing java applications using riak in a jvm environment. Riak time series database riak time series ts database from basho is an open source, distributed nosql keyvalue stored optimised database for the internet of things iot. This book guides you through the process of using riak for anything from simple to complex data.

52 1282 735 1455 1286 818 313 1517 692 945 1222 1113 506 1352 441 262 1010 756 506 1183 1517 282 1306 435 1196 525 380 1332 362 1448 959 536 459 198 932 1034 59 351